In terms of precipitation, rainfall in Virginia ranges from 2.9 - 5.8 inches per month. July is typically the wettest month, when rainfall can reach 5.8 in. November is typically the driest time to visit Virginia when rainfall is around 2.9 in.
If weather is an important factor for your trip to Virginia, use this chart to help with planning. For those seeking warmer temperatures, July is the ideal time of year to visit, when temperatures reach an average of 78.8 F. Travelers looking to avoid the cold should look outside of January, when temperatures are typically at their lowest (around 42.8 F).
